Sha256: 202d14d4dbae916bbaddc623fa43a1327dd7c20da8b94cd796b2a07712b22ddd

Contents?: true

Size: 278 Bytes

Versions: 1

Compression:

Stored size: 278 Bytes

Contents

class Hash
  # str8 from activesupport core_ext/hash/keys.rb
  def symbolize_keys
    inject({}) do |options, (key, value)|
      options[(key.to_sym rescue key) || key] = value
      options
    end
  end
  def symbolize_keys!
    self.replace(self.symbolize_keys)
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
subprocess-0.1.6 lib/core_ext/hash.rb